B.A.P. Unión Returns to Callao From Training Voyage as President José Jerí Leads Reception

The sail training ship capped a mission blending cadet instruction with cultural outreach across 10 ports in nine countries.

Overview

  • Jerí greeted the crew at the Naval School in Callao on November 8 alongside senior cabinet members and naval leadership.
  • RPP reports 255 personnel aboard including 71 Naval School cadets, while Correo lists 155 crew plus 71 cadets.
  • The ship departed Callao on May 9 and completed a circuit that included the North Atlantic with stops in the United States, Panama and other ports.
  • Coverage describes the voyage as lasting six months or 178 days, reflecting differing counts by outlets.
  • Cadets conducted hands-on training in maneuver, navigation and leadership as the crew promoted Peruvian culture, tourism and commercial ties at each port, including Matarani in Arequipa.
